Robert A. Heinlein's "The Brass Cannon." Grandmaster science-fiction author, Robert A. Heinlein, originally titled his Hugo-winning novel, The Moon is a Harsh Mistress, "The Brass Cannon," after a Revolutionary-War-style cannon that he fired off each July 4th. In this video you can see this cannon fired at the Angeles Shooting Range and learn its history from science-fiction writers Brad Linaweaver, J. Kent Hastings, and J. Neil Schulman, and its restorer, Randy Herrst. Narrated by Brad Linaweaver, who received the cannon as a bequest from Virginia Heinlein.

I was the one who rebuilt the cannon and set it up for firing. Powder = black powder FFg grade. The only projectile was a ball of paper wadding, because this is a "salute cannon" and the 1" bore is not final-finished. Such roughness when combined with a solid projectile would cause high risk of pressure spikes that could blow up the cannon.
A blown up cannon would not have pleased either the history fans, nor the people who were using the cannon on the range! :-D
